SCHEMA_NAME (Transact-SQL)
Se aplica a:SQL ServerAzure SQL DatabaseAzure SQL Managed InstanceAzure Synapse AnalyticsAnalytics Platform System (PDW)Punto de conexión de análisis SQL en Microsoft FabricAlmacenamiento en Microsoft Fabric
Devuelve el nombre de esquema asociado a un Id. de esquema.
Convenciones de sintaxis de Transact-SQL
Sintaxis
SCHEMA_NAME ( [ schema_id ] )
Nota:
Para ver la sintaxis de Transact-SQL para SQL Server 2014 (12.x) y versiones anteriores, consulte Versiones anteriores de la documentación.
Argumentos
Término | Definición |
---|---|
schema_id | Id. del esquema. schema_id es un int. Si schema_id no se define, SCHEMA_NAME devolverá el nombre del esquema predeterminado del autor de llamada. |
Tipos de valor devuelto
sysname
Devuelve NULL cuando schema_id no es un Id. válido.
Comentarios
SCHEMA_NAME devuelve nombres de esquemas del sistema y esquemas definidos por el usuario. SCHEMA_NAME se puede llamar en una lista de selección, en una cláusula WHERE y en cualquier lugar en el que se permita una expresión.
Ejemplos
A. Devolver el nombre del esquema predeterminado del llamador
SELECT SCHEMA_NAME();
B. Devolver el nombre de un esquema utilizando un Id.
SELECT SCHEMA_NAME(1);
Consulte también
Expresiones (Transact-SQL)
SCHEMA_ID (Transact-SQL)
sys.schemas (Transact-SQL)
sys.database_principals (Transact-SQL)
Funciones de metadatos (Transact-SQL)
WHERE (Transact-SQL)
Comentarios
https://aka.ms/ContentUserFeedback.
Próximamente: A lo largo de 2024 iremos eliminando gradualmente GitHub Issues como mecanismo de comentarios sobre el contenido y lo sustituiremos por un nuevo sistema de comentarios. Para más información, vea:Enviar y ver comentarios de